It was later revealed that Koval was a Federation operative and had been working with Starfleet Intelligence for more than a year. The “assassination plot” to kill him was a collaborative effort between Starfleet, Section 31 and Koval himself to ensure Kimara Cretak’s dismissal from the Senate, thus giving him Cretak's seat on the Continuing Committee. Koval’s placement gave the Federation an ally inside the highest reaches of the Romulan government.
